Summer Sundae returns with an extra day!
United Kingdom | |
10 April 2003
Now in its third year, this chilled-out music festival boasts an intimate, family-friendly atmosphere over two large-scale stages, one outdoor using De Montfort Hall's natural amphitheatre, and one indoor in the main hall.
The festival expands this year to include 2 brand new smaller-scale marquee stages, one stage for emerging artists and one for acoustic acts in association with the Musician, a live music venue in Leicester. The festival will also boast camping facilities at the adjacent green fields in the grounds of Regent College.

BBC 6 Music's Bob Harris, who introduced the bands on stage last year, commented on the festival "The view and sound for everyone was excellent, very intimate and just very, very nice." Richard Haswell, Manager at the Hall said "We are all very excited about how the festival is continuing to grow with new stages and camping being added this year for the first time." Richard added "We're pushing towards being one of the established national festivals of the summer calendar, which is helping to put Leicester on the map. The Summer Sundae Festival is delighted to be the first major music festival in the UK to participate in Oxfam's Festival Rewards Scheme. With £1 of the ticket price going direct to the charity, each ticketholder will receive access to a whole host of Freebies and Offers on a wide range of DVD's, CD's, Magazines, Books, Computer Games and Videos.
